About the Book:
After Tova Sullivan's husband died, she began working the night shift at the Sowell Bay Aquarium, mopping floors and keeping busy — her way of coping since her son Erik mysteriously vanished on a boat in Puget Sound over thirty years ago.
There, Tova becomes acquainted with curmudgeonly Marcellus, a giant Pacific octopus with a sharp mind and a secret. Marcellus knows what happened the night Erik disappeared — and he'll use every trick his old invertebrate body can muster to unearth the truth before it's too late.
